Uses of Interface
org.springframework.cloud.vault.config.SecretBackendMetadata
-
Uses of SecretBackendMetadata in org.springframework.cloud.vault.config
Subinterfaces of SecretBackendMetadata in org.springframework.cloud.vault.configModifier and TypeInterfaceDescriptioninterfaceLease extension toSecretBackendMetadataproviding alease mode.Classes in org.springframework.cloud.vault.config that implement SecretBackendMetadataModifier and TypeClassDescriptionclassSecretBackendMetadatafor thekv(key-value) secret backend.classSupport class forSecretBackendMetadataimplementations.classProvides a convenient implementation of theSecretBackendMetadatainterface that can be subclassed to override specific methods.Methods in org.springframework.cloud.vault.config that return SecretBackendMetadataModifier and TypeMethodDescriptionstatic SecretBackendMetadatastatic SecretBackendMetadatastatic SecretBackendMetadataKeyValueSecretBackendMetadata.create(String path, org.springframework.vault.core.util.PropertyTransformer propertyTransformer) SecretBackendMetadataFactory.createMetadata(T backendDescriptor) Converts aVaultSecretBackendDescriptorinto aSecretBackendMetadata.VaultConfigLocation.getSecretBackendMetadata()Methods in org.springframework.cloud.vault.config that return types with arguments of type SecretBackendMetadataMethods in org.springframework.cloud.vault.config with parameters of type SecretBackendMetadataModifier and TypeMethodDescriptionSecretBackendConfigurer.add(SecretBackendMetadata metadata) Add aSecretBackendMetadata.protected abstract org.springframework.core.env.PropertySource<?> VaultPropertySourceLocatorSupport.createVaultPropertySource(SecretBackendMetadata accessor) CreateVaultPropertySourceinitialized with aSecretBackendMetadata.VaultConfigOperations.read(SecretBackendMetadata secretBackendMetadata) Read secrets from a secret backend encapsulated within aSecretBackendMetadata.VaultConfigTemplate.read(SecretBackendMetadata secretBackendMetadata) Constructors in org.springframework.cloud.vault.config with parameters of type SecretBackendMetadataModifierConstructorDescriptionCreate a newSecretBackendMetadataWrappergivenSecretBackendMetadata.VaultConfigLocation(SecretBackendMetadata secretBackendMetadata, boolean optional) Create a newVaultConfigLocationinstance.